On Friday, August 20, join PulpFest 2021 as we welcome Doug Ellis for “The Weird Tales of Margaret Brundage,” a look at the stories behind the front cover illustrations created by the WEIRD TALES artist.

On Friday, August 20, PulpFest and ERBFest 2021 will welcome Christopher Carey & Cathy Wilbanks of Edgar Rice Burroughs, Inc. to the convention. Join them for "The News from Tarzana" at the conventions.

On PulpFest's Instagram page, we've been showing the SHADOW art of George Rozen & Graves Gladney. On Thursday & Friday, we'll have some of the less frequent Shadow artists, including William Timmins, Walter Swenson, and Bob Powell. Be sure to follow us at https://t.co/NOO7msRlnk
